Theft Under $5000

On June 2nd at 08:39am Police received a call from a business in the 900 block of Victoria Avenue reporting a female had stolen cosmetics and sushi and fled in a vehicle. Officers located the vehicle in the 800 block of Pacific Avenue ad conducted a traffic stop. A 31-year-old female was arrested. She was also found to have a knife with a brass knuckles type of grip in her possession. She was later released for court on August 24th, 2024.

Assault by Choking

On June 2nd at 05:58 am Police received a call from a resident in the 900 block of Breacrest. A 33-year-old male reported being awoken to someone trying to get into his apartment. He confronted the male and told him to leave but the male lunged at him and choked him. A brief struggle ensued, and the suspect took off. Police were able to identify the accused and find him in another apartment. A 25-year-old male was arrested for assault. It turns out he thought he was going into his own apartment earlier. He will appear in court on August 15th, 2024.

Breach of Release Order and Assault with a Weapon

On June 2nd at 9:53 pm Police were called to a business in the 000 of 10th street. It was reported that a male and female were purchasing beer at the vendor. The male asked the female to pay for the beer and then she stabbed him with a knife. They both left the business. Officers located the pair a short distance away. The 32-year-old male refused to cooperate with police and stated he was not injured. No serious injuries observed. The 24-year-old female was arrested as she was on an order not attend to the business. She will be later released for court on August 1st, 2024.

Robbery with Firearm

On June 3rd at 02:21 am Officers were dealing with an unrelated call in the 500 block of Lorne Avenue when a 32-year-old male approached them reported he was robbed. The male stated he was walking down the street when a male approached him with what he believed to be a gun and demanded his cell phone. The suspect then took off with the cell phone. Police attempted a K-9 track but were unsuccessful due to so much foot traffic in the area. This matter is still under investigation.

Arson

On June 3rd at 02:16 am Police were called to a dumpster fire behind a residence in the 200 block of 5th street. The fire spread and two vehicles were damaged but thankfully the fire was extinguished before a home was lost.

At 03:12 am Police were then advised of a dumpster fire behind a business in the 800 block of 18th street north. A black car was observed speeding through the parking lot around the time of the fire. Both fires appear suspicious, and officers continue to investigate. Police are requesting anyone with video surveillance in either area to please check to see if they caught anything suspicious.
